Police: Men in black robbed Fayetteville convenience store
FAYETTEVILLE, N.C. — Fayetteville police are searching for two men who robbed a convenience store Sunday night.

Authorities said that two men dressed in all black entered the Easy Pass Food Mart at 1805 Sapona Road at about 8:35 p.m.

The men, one of whom had a handgun, demanded the clerk open the cash register and took an undetermined amount of cash before fleeing in a gray four-door sedan.

Authorities said the men should be considered armed and dangerous.

Anybody with information is asked to call Fayetteville police at 910-580-3016 or Crime Stoppers at 910-483-8477.
